CREAMY AVOCADO DRESSING



Creamy Avocado Dressing image

Recipe video above. This is a dressing that uses avocado to make it creamy, rather than mayonnaise or loads of oil. It doesn't taste very avocado-ey because avocados are dense so it needs to be thinned out to make it pourable as a dressing. Rather, think of the avocado as the better-for-you means to get a creamy dressing fix!Excellent use for avocados that are a bit overripe or with brown spotty bits. Use as dressing for all your favourite salads. Particularly good salads that call for Ranch, Caesar or other mayo-rich dressings.Makes 1 1/4 cups - enough for a side salad for 6 to 8 (depending on how much you use!)

Provided by Nagi

Categories     Side Salad

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/2 cup ripe avocado ((smush into cup to measure, or estimate - 1/2 medium avo))
3 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
3 tbsp sour cream or yogurt ((Greek or plain, unsweetened) - OPTIONAL (Note 1))
2 tbsp lemon juice
1 garlic clove, small (, minced using garlic crusher (Note 2))
4 tbsp water ((to thin out, it's very rich!))
1/2 tsp salt
1/4 tsp black pepper
See Note 3

Steps:

  • Place all ingredients into a Nutribullet or small food processor and blitz until smooth. (Inc Extra Flavouring Options)
  • Use water to thin to just pourable consistency (so it's not super gloopy and thick).
  • Taste and add the following to taste: salt, pepper, lemon, oil. Use as salad dressing!
  • Keeps 3 days in the fridge without going brown. See Note 3 for how to keep even longer!

AVOCADO DRESSING



Avocado Dressing image

I adapted this recipe from another recipe for avocado dressing that I wanted to make more healthful.

Provided by LiebAR

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Salad Dressing Recipes     Yogurt Dressing Recipes

Time 10m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 avocado, peeled and pitted
½ cup plain yogurt
¼ cup extra-virgin olive oil
3 tablespoons lemon juice
2 cloves garlic
1 teaspoon sea salt
¼ teaspoon hot pepper sauce
⅛ teaspoon 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Blend avocado, yogurt, ol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, sea salt, hot sauce, and black pepper together in a blender until smooth.

CREAMY AVOCADO WASABI DRESSING



Creamy Avocado Wasabi Dressing image

This is a nice, tangy dressing, and also makes a good topping for crab cakes! Prep time includes refrigeration.

Provided by Julesong

Categories     Salad Dressings

Time 1h

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 tablespoons hot wasabi
1 ripe avocado, peeled,seeded,and chunked
1 tablespoon plain yogurt or 1 tablespoon sour cream
3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
1/2 teaspoon lemon juice
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1 pinch salt, to taste
1 pinch sugar, to taste
1 pinch black pepper, to taste
sake or dry white wine

Steps:

  • Puree all ingredients together well, adding sake or other dry white wine to the desired consistency, then chill for at least 1 hour.
  • Serve as dressing.
  • Also good with crab cakes!
  • Note: make sure to use a fully ripe avocado for this recipe! It needs to be ripe and rich - Californian (Haas or Gwen) avocados have a buttery and richer flavor than avocados from Florida or other areas. Otherwise your dressing will come out tasting a little flat.

AVOCADO SALAD DRESSING



Avocado Salad Dressing image

Tired of the usual vinaigrette or creamy white stuff? This does wonders for a green salad and also goes well with seafood. It's from "The Spice Cookbook" but my version ups the garlic a bit.

Provided by Marla Swoffer

Categories     Salad Dressings

Time 5m

Yield 1 cup

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 avocado
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on chili powder
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1 dash cayenne

Steps:

  • Mash avocado with lemon juice until it is smooth.
  • Add remaining ingredients and mix well.

CREAMY AVOCADO SALAD DRESSING



Creamy Avocado Salad Dressing image

Healthy avocados make this vinagrette based dressing creamy! Wonderful on green salads, or as a dip for crudite. Change up the flavor by using a different vinegar, or lime juice instead of lemon. Try it tossed with cooked quinoa or bulgur for an easy grain salad. Serving is 2 tablespoons.

Provided by Raquel Grinnell

Categories     < 15 Mins

Time 10m

Yield 2 cups, 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 avocados, halved and pitted (make sure they are ripe, not hard)
1 garlic clove
1 lemon, juice of
1/3 cup rice wine vinegar
1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
salt and pepper

Steps:

  • Scoop the avocado flesh into the bowl of a food processor. Add the garlic clove and lemon juice and process until coarse.
  • Add the vinegar and process until the mixture begins to look smooth. Gradually add the olive oil and mix until totally smooth. The texture can be thinned by adding a few tablespoons of water, if desired.
  • Season the dressing to taste with salt and pepper, and transfer it to a storage container. The dressing will keep for up to three days in a sealed container in the refrigerator.

AVOCADO VINAIGRETTE SALAD DRESSING



Avocado Vinaigrette Salad Dressing image

Make and share this Avocado Vinaigrette Salad Dressing rec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Rise3834

Categories     Sauces

Time 5m

Yield 1 cup,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 large ripe avocado (or 3 small)
2 garlic cloves
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ano (or 1 tbls fresh)
1/4 teaspoon white pepper (optional)
1/3 cup garlic-flavored red wine vinegar
2/3 cup olive oil
1 fresh serrano pepper (or jalapeno pepper-optional for heat)

Steps:

  • Place all ingredients except the olive oil in a blender (I personally use a stand up stick model in a bowl). As you begin to blend, slowly pour in olive oil to desired consistency. If you like it tangy, you may wish to add more vinegar if you like it thinner you may want to use more olive oil. Add salt to taste.
  • If you want it spicy, add a serrano or jalapeno pepper(s). Anyone that knows me or my recipes knows that I adore garlic, spice and vinegar so my taste may be stronger than yours for these items, adjust accordingly.
  • This is an excellent dressing for any salad but is exceptionally good on a grilled chicken southwestern salad. Also good in place of cocktail sauce for a change to shrimp cocktails.

AVOCADO SALAD DRESSING RECIPE (HEALTHY & CREAMY)
avocado-salad-dressing-recipe-healthy-creamy image
2021-06-17 Instructions. Place lime or lemon juice, olive oil, avocados, garlic, jalapeno, cilantro, 3/4 teaspoon salt, and black pepper into the bowl of a food …
From foolproofliving.com
Ratings 10
Calories 173 per serving
Category Dressing
  • Place lime or lemon juice, olive oil, avocados, garlic, jalapeno, cilantro, 3/4 teaspoon salt, and black pepper into the bowl of a food processor. Process 4-5 minutes or until creamy. Scrape down the bowl with a spatula a few times during the process.
  • If you want a more liquidy avocado dressing add in almond milk in one tablespoon increments until it reaches to the consistency you desire.
  • Place in a jar, place a piece of stretch film on top of the surface of the dressing to keep it from browning, and close it tightly with a lid. As long as it is kept in the fridge, this dressing will be good for 4-5 days.
